The Borough Lancaster ★★★★
"We stayed one night ten days apart in the newly refurbished rooms in the courtyard. The bed was huge and lovely and comfy. The evening meal and breakfast the next day were delicious and generous portions. They cater for gluten free, vegetarian and vegan. The bar looked well stocked with an array of wines and spirits. All the staff we met were friendly and chatty and made us welcome. Ideal place to stop on our drive to Scotland and back again. We had to pay for overnight parking very nearby but plenty of spaces and not unreasonable."
Secret Suites ★★★★
"My wife and I have stayed in both Suite 1 and Suite 2 at Secret Suites. Most recently, Suite 2. The rooms are decorated and furnished to an extremely high standard and the rooms scream luxury. In Suite 2 there is a massive jacuzzi bath that I could've soaked in for hours. There were clear and concise instructions on how to use the jacuzzi bath, which was very helpful. The fridge in the suite was stocked up with complimentary prosecco, beer, coke and water. There is also a coffee machine and a kettle for the morning brew with a selection of biscuits. The TV is a good size and has apps like Netflix and Prime all set up, ready to go. The bed is like sleeping on a cloud, it was so comfy. We had the best night sleep. There is an outside seating area, which will be great when it comes to summer time, it was a bit nippy when we went, so didn't have chance to use this facility. Secret Suites is located in the centre of Lancaster, so there are plenty of pubs, cafe's and restaurants at a walking distance. There is the option for parking, but if private parking isn't available, there are plenty of local pay and display car parks that aren't too expensive. The owners were very welcoming and communication was superb. All updates sent to me via WhatsApp with key code, parking, etc all sent promptly. I'd highly recommend Secret Suite's and we can't wait to go back again."

North Lodge
"We booked this property for a group gathering, largely because it advertised a hot tub, garden and outdoor space, which we planned to use for a family barbecue and breakfast. We came prepared with food, only to find on arrival that the outdoor area was completely unusable. The garden was poorly maintained, overgrown, strewn with rubbish and unclean, with broken fencing and rusted barbecue/fire pit equipment. The area was not in a condition we felt able to use. As this was a key reason for choosing the property, it was extremely disappointing and meant we had to change our plans and pay to eat out instead. When we raised these issues on our return, the management company and owner took no responsibility, offering only excuses and even suggesting we must be referring to a different property. Based on other reviews, this does not appear to be an isolated experience. The property itself has real potential. The building is attractive and the location is excellent, but it is very basic and in clear need of updating. Outdoor maintenance and proper cleaning are urgently required. The beds are uncomfortable, the bathrooms are very small and the living areas feel tired. Overall, a disappointing stay, made worse by the lack of accountability."
